The effective date of the Trademark Law Revision Act of 1988, referred to in subsec. (b)(5), is one year after Nov. 16, 1988. See section 136 of Pub. L. 100–667, set out as an Effective Date of 1988 Amendment note under section 1051 of this title.

A bill to amend the Act entitled "An Act to provide for the registration and protection of trade-marks used in commerce, to carry out the provisions of certain international conventions, and … WebThe Trademark Dilution Revision Act of 2006 (H.R. 683, Pub. L. 109–312 (text) (PDF)) was a law passed in the United States covering trademark law, and specifically dealt with trademark dilution . The act amended the Trademark Act of 1946 and the later Federal Trademark Dilution Act, and was passed through the United States House of ...

For instance, there are many companies which produce mobile phones but … thailand tsunami 2012 death tollWebSummary of Trademark Law. Trademark law governs the use of a device (including a word, phrase, symbol, product shape, or logo) by a manufacturer or merchant to identify its goods and to distinguish those goods from those made or sold by another. Service marks, which are used on services rather than goods, are also governed by 'Trademark law.'. synchro siteWebUnited States trademark law is mainly governed by the Lanham Act.
